About The Position

The digital photography/videography contractor position will provide support to the Department of Defense Cyber Crime Center (DC3) Public Affairs Office (PAO) on the planning and designing of concepts to represent internal and external communications initiatives. This includes but is not limited to: Multimedia Production (animations), Physical Media Production (compact discs (CDs)/digital video discs (DVDs)), DC3 logos, artwork, flyers, brochures, templates and layout for websites, email marketing blasts, newsletters, white papers, brochures, articles, and other written documents. The contractor will specialize in capturing and creating high-quality images and videos for various mission-related activities using digital cameras and editing software to produce visually appealing and engaging content. This may include studio (portrait), lifestyle, technical, editorial, and off-site promotional styles of photography. Overall, the digital photography/videography contractor will play a crucial role in creating visually appealing content that helps the Department of Defense Cyber Crime Center (DC3) showcase their mission, products and services in a compelling way.

Requirements

  • Proven experience in digital photography and videography.
  • Proficiency in using digital cameras, lighting equipment, and editing software.
  • Strong eye for detail and composition.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
  • Strong organizational and time-management skills.
  • Flexibility and adaptability.
  • Knowledge of current trends and techniques in digital photography and videography.
  • Portfolio of previous work demonstrating skills and abilities in digital photography and videography.
  • Active TS/SCI clearance.
  • Associates degree and 7+ years of experience; OR Bachelor's degree and 5+ years of experience; OR Master's Degree and 3+ years of experience; OR 0 years with PhD. However, four (4) years of additional relevant experience or specialized training will be considered in lieu of a Bachelor's degree.
  • Previous work experience as a Civilian, Government Contractor or Military pre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Review and respond promptly to service desk tickets.
  • Plan and execute photo and video shoots, including setting up lighting, backdrops, and props.
  • Capture high-quality images and videos that meet DC3 Leadership requirements and specifications.
  • Edit and retouch photos and videos using editing software to enhance their quality and appeal.
  • Collaborate with DC3 Leadership to ensure their vision corresponds to the mission.
  • Stay up-to-date with the latest trends and techniques in digital photography and videography.
  • Manage and maintain equipment, including cameras, lenses, lighting, and accessories.
  • Organize and maintain a digital library of photos and videos for easy access and retrieval.
  • Meet project deadlines and deliver final products in a timely manner.
  • Communicate effectively with DC3 Leadership to understand their needs and provide exceptional service.
  • Support the development and distribution of news sent to internal recipients.
  • Assist the DC3 PAO in documenting strategic, operational, and tactical engagements and communications in SOPs for operational efficiency and continuity of operations requirements.
